Exports In 2023, Bahamas exported $16.7k in Water, making it the 140th largest exporter of Water in the world. At the same year, Water was the 266th most exported product in Bahamas. The main destination of Water exports from Bahamas are: United States ($14.5k), Namibia ($1.23k), Spain ($454), Canada ($375), and Cyprus ($72).
The fastest growing export markets for Water of Bahamas between 2022 and 2023 were United States ($1.34k), Namibia ($1.23k), and Spain ($328).
Imports In 2023, Bahamas imported $8.03M in Water, becoming the 63rd largest importer of Water in the world. At the same year, Water was the 123rd most imported product in Bahamas. Bahamas imports Water primarily from: United States ($7.38M), Mexico ($430k), Brazil ($75.8k), Germany ($45.2k), and Greece ($27.4k).
The fastest growing import markets in Water for Bahamas between 2022 and 2023 were Mexico ($428k), Germany ($40.2k), and Greece ($26.8k).
